Moniek Merkx

is a freelance director, writer, teacher and dramaturge. Until 2021, she was artistic director of Maas theatre and dance in Rotterdam. She works for a large number of theatre and mime companies in the Netherlands and abroad. Merkx wrote Eerste hulp bij theater (First Aid for Theatre) together with Jowi Schmitz and Dorien Folkers. Her work is associative, visual and musical. Her well-known theatre titles include: Blauw of iets voor aan de muur (Blue or Something for the Wall), Maanvirus (Moon Virus), De verschrikkelijke stiefmoedershow (The Terrible Stepmother Show), Alleen op de wereld (Alone in the World), Help, Staal, Once upon the Forest, City of Dreams, Voorjaarsoffer (Spring Sacrifice), Liefde (Love), Hallo familie (Hello Family), Lampje (Little Light), Zinderella, LOVEXL and Die Schneekonigin (The Snow Queen). For her work, she has received several youth theatre awards in the Netherlands (Hans Snoek Prize, 1000Watt Prize, Gouden/Zilveren Krekels, Podiumkids Prize) and the VSCD Mime Prize. In the US, she won the Tony Award together with The Children's Theatre Company in Minneapolis. In 2021, Moniek became a member of the Academy of Arts (part of the Royal Netherlands Academy of Arts and Sciences, KNAW).
